Calcitonin Defined

A hormone formed by the C cells of the thyroid gland. It helps maintain a healthy level of calcium in the blood. When the calcium level is too high, calcitonin lowers it.

What Is Osteoporosis? What Causes Osteoporosis?

Published June 28, 2009, 1:05 pm, Medical News Today

The bones of people with osteoporosis become thin and weak. The word "osteo" comes from the Greek osteon meaning "bone", while "porosis" comes from the Greek poros meaning "hole, passage".
